Property Overview: 270 Dumoulin Street, North St. Boniface

Key Characteristics & Appeal

This home presents a practical opportunity in Winnipeg's North St. Boniface neighbourhood. Built in 1945, it offers 1,144 sqft of living space, which is comfortably within the average range for the immediate street and area. Its assessed value of $295k sits below the city-wide average, suggesting a potentially more accessible entry point into the market compared to many Winnipeg homes.

The appeal lies in its established, no-surprises positioning. It’s not the largest or newest home on the block, but its metrics are consistently mid-range for its specific community. This can indicate a stable, mature setting without the premium often attached to recently renovated or oversized lots. The lot size of just over 4,000 sqft is smaller than many in the city, which may translate to less maintenance—a plus for downsizers or those seeking a simpler yard.

This property would suit a first-time buyer or a practical-minded individual looking for a character home in a long-established neighbourhood without venturing into a major fixer-upper. It’s also a candidate for someone who values the specific culture and convenience of St. Boniface and prefers a home that is already competitively positioned within its local market, rather than being an outlier.


Frequently Asked Questions

1. Is the assessed value a reliable indicator of the likely selling price?
The assessed value ($295k) is for municipal tax purposes. Notably, it is below the average for both the wider city and the local area. Recent sold data for the street shows a home sold in early 2022 in the $300k-$350k range, which can provide a more current market reference point.

2. How does the lot size impact the property?
At 4,043 sqft, the lot is smaller than many in Winnipeg. This means less outdoor maintenance, which can be a benefit, but also offers less space for expansions, large gardens, or detached structures compared to neighbouring properties.

3. What does the age of the home (1945) mean for a buyer?
A home from this era likely has classic character but may also have older building systems, wiring, or plumbing. It’s wise to budget for updates that align with the home's age and to have a thorough inspection.

4. How does this home compare to its immediate neighbours?
The provided data shows direct neighbours (e.g., 266, 272 Dumoulin) are very close, typical of a mature street. The home’s living area and assessed value are generally on par with or slightly below averages for Dumoulin Street itself, indicating it fits seamlessly into the streetscape.
